# CycleShift client setup
#
# This block configures the client for RackBalance, our internal service
# that computes dock-level rebalancing moves for the Velden bike-share
# network. New folks: the client only needs the base URL and an API key;
# everything else (retries, timeouts) uses defaults from conf/rackbalance.yml.
# The key is scoped to read station inventory and post move suggestions,
# nothing more. For local development, use the shared sandbox key
# provided on the next line.

service key, tadup-tahog: zpat7_wB1tnEL

## Runbook: Quenchflow autoscaler

Welcome aboard. Quenchflow scales our worker fleet based on queue depth in the Millpond broker. It polls every 30 seconds and adds or drains workers to keep backlog under target. If it's flapping, it's almost always the cooldown being too short or the thresholds too tight. Check the current values first — here's what it's running with.

deployment values, fahap-hahaf:
[casdor]
port = 9200
region = south-2
host = casdor.qirvanworks.corp
timeout_ms = 3000
retries = 4

# Heads up: these constants govern the Bramblewick partner SFTP drop.
# Files land nightly and the poller picks them up on the interval below.
# If a release shifts the partner's schedule, bump the window here —
# don't hardcode it in the job. Retries back off exponentially and
# give up after the cap. Current values are as follows.

tuning table, kajog-bawip:
TIERS = {
    "kelius": 256,
    "lammir": 543,
}

## Deployment

The Renderloft transcoding farm deploys through the Quillgate pipeline in three stages: build, canary, and full rollout. As a new contractor, please deploy only to the canary pool until your access review clears. Each worker node pulls its encoding profiles from the Farriver artifact store at boot, so never edit profiles on a live node. Verify the canary passes the smoke suite before promoting. The farm reads the following configuration at startup, which you should review before your first deploy.

config for kajef-hahof:
[ulamir]
port = 5672
region = central-1
host = ulamir.lumicsys.corp
timeout_ms = 2000
retries = 3